This paper predicts the effects that high levels of photovoltaic penetration will have on the voltage magnitude and power flow on five actual North American feeders. The studies are based on EPRI test feeders, and simulations are conducted using EPRI's OpenDSS computer simulation program. Results for the five feeders studied, using PV penetration levels of 50% of total load, show that the voltage flicker due to shadow movement will be approximately in the range of 0.5% to 2%.Index Terms--distributed power generation, photovoltaic, voltage fluctiations.
